1. Insert a brochure for another product in the first product package your customer buys from you.

2. Sell a basic product and tell people for a little more money they can receive the deluxe edition.

3. Give your customers a free subscription to your e-zine and include back end products in each issue.

4. Charge people extra money to get the reproduction rights.

5. Send your customers greeting cards at holidays with your back end product offer included.

6. Offer your customers a discount if they buy more than one of the same product.

7. Include a back end product offer on your online “thank you” page.

8. Give people a huge discount to your subscription product if they subscribe for a longer period of time.

9. Send your customer a free surprise gift with your back end product offer included.

10. Give your customers a discount if they buy over a certain number of any products.

11. Publish a back end product offer inside any of the information products you sell.

12. Group your products together in package deals to make more profit form each sale.

13. Include a back end product offer inside your “customer’s only” online club.

14. Join someone else’s affiliate program and use it as an upsell or back end product.

15. Follow-up with your customers to see if they’re happy and offer them another product.

16. Offer people a free sample of your product and tell them they will get a discount if they order now.

17. Send your customers a “thank you” e-mail with a back end offer attached.

18. Offer your customers add-on products like gift wrapping, batteries, imprinting, etc.

19. Allow your customers the option of signing up to your “future product offers list”.

20. Explain to people that for extra money, they can extend the guarantee or warranty of the product. —-

Free For All Sites (FFA) are sites where a person is able to post a link with a short ad to a website, many times it also posts to many other similar sites at the same time, creating free advertising and free backlinks to the poster. When someone posts a link, they are agreeing whether they know it or not, to receive a confirmation email back from the site’s owner.

What seems to happen though is many people see this as free advertising and get angry when, not only do they not see a flood of sales come pouring in, but they start receiving other people’s offers. I know when the first time it happened to me, I couldn’t figure out what was going on and was frustrated at the results.

Let’s back the truck up a minute and really explore what just happened and the true purpose of a FFA site. The real purpose is for the site owner to promote his business or product to you. He’s just just being a nice person giving people free advertising space. If it worked that way, he’d be using it as his own goldmine. This is just the bait so people will post their site, so they can send their offers to you via their confirmation link. Brilliant isn’t it?

The confirmation emails you receive are not considered spam, as you had agreed to receive them for the privilege of posting on their site. Who reads these ads anyways? Is posting to FFA’s a total waste of time then? Not necessarily, as you will get an occasional sale, people do go back and post repeated ads and sometimes take a quick look while trying to see where their links are.

To get the real benefit of FFAs for your business, get your own FFA site so you can promote to those who post to it. Shop around among the many resources of them to find which suites you best. Most have paid and free versions, but the saying “you get what you pay for” comes to mind here. I have done several paid versions that more than compensated for their cost.

Many things can be promoted through FFA sites, information products, crafts, vitamins, and anything else you are selling. If you don’t have traffic coming to your site, it doesn’t matter how great what you have is, you won’t have sales. These sites provide methods to get traffic to your site. Free classified websites work in pretty much the same concept and can be another method worth pursuing.

Before beginning to sell information products online, make sure that you are targeting a niche that will be profitable in the short-term as well as in the future. Your niche is simply a different way of saying your target audience.

Some niches, as you’ll discover, aren’t as profitable as others. You need to look at your audience and see if they’re willing (and able) to spend money for the solutions they’re seeking.

For instance, golfers have deep pockets because the game of golf in itself is expensive. They’re also rabid fans of the game who would do anything to improve their score or beat their competitors on the links.

Another potential target audience such as single moms on a budget may be reluctant to pay $67 for an eBook on getting organized, but if you target a different problem of theirs they are willing to pay. For instance, many may be willing to pay $47 for an eBook which teaches them how to make more money working at home than they make on their 9-5 jobs.

One excellent place to begin is with checking out online groups and forums. You can visit iVillage, or Yahoo groups, Google groups, or Boardtracker and determine what sort of groups garner the most posts. Men’s groups such as AskMen might provide some insight into which types of information products this segment of the population might need which you can provide at a handsome profit.

You’re not only looking for large group of people to market to – you are looking for the large group that has a lot of problems in common which need solutions. As you start creating information products, you will want to concentrate on building a whole line of products in one niche to begin with. This will allow you to market to loyal existing customers who will buy from you many different times.

In some instances, you’ll find a large niche market and then realize you need to develop your information product line around a more targeted, narrow section of that niche. For example, parents are a group with plenty of problems you could potentially address. Raising intelligent kids, saving money, preventing drug and dealing with discipline, use might be a few.

But you can then narrow that niche to moms or dads and dig deeper by focusing on parents of multiples or parents raising kids with physical ailments. Just remember that an information product is not really a product at all – it’s a solution, so it needs to be marketed as something that will improve lives

Audio is becoming the “next big thing” on the internet lately. We’re finding welcome messages on websites, audio blogging, podcasts, even audio newsletters sent out once or twice a month. Internet surfers are enjoying audio and today’s technology is making it so simple for us to download audio to our MP3 players, listening to it whenever we like.

You can take audio files that you had for any interviews you are conducting for information products or articles and make money with them in other ways. You can do this in the following ways:

By offering a product upgrade: If you have already created a written info product (ebook or special report) and have conducted interviews while doing research for the product, you can then offer the audio files as an upgrade to the base product. For instance, if you offer the basic product for $19.99, you can include the audio files to the customer for an upgraded price of $24.95 or higher, depending on how much audio there is to accompany the product.

Product Downgrade: On the opposite side of the above description, you can use audio files as a downgrade to an existing product. If you have a coaching program that includes written guides, audio interviews with experts, and one-on-one or group coaching, you could offer the audio interviews as a downgrade for those who can’t afford the whole package. For example, you could price the total package at $199, but offer the audios for those that want to “self-study” for a price of $75. Those that can’t afford $199 will feel that they are getting a good bargain, and you will have turned a “non-sell” into a $75 sell.

Audio Information Product: In addition to the product upgrade and downgrade features, you could offer audio files as entirely new information products. In addition to selling interviews with experts you recorded as research for existing information products, you could invite people who have already purchased the product onto a teleconference line for a question and answer session with you, and possibly, the other experts you interviewed when creating the product. You could record the q&a session and offer it to all future customers.

Seminar Series: A great way to generate some traffic for your site, create buzz, and make money is to offer a seminar series. You can approach other business owners that your target market will find interesting and ask if they would like to be a part of your seminar series.

Depending on how much traffic you currently have, you may be able to charge the presenters a fee to have a spot in your seminar as well. You can opt to allow people to dial in on a teleconference line or meet in a web conference room and listen to the live seminar for free, and then charge a fee for access to the recordings of the seminars. Alternatively, you can charge a fee upfront and only give paying customers access to the live seminars.

As you can see, there are numerous ways to make money with your interviews. You will find readers will enjoy hearing your voice, as well as hearing from other experts. With a little organization, you can bring a whole new stream of income with your audio interviews.

There are many ways to handle the manufacturing & shipping of your DVDs. I prefer a service called Kunaki which takes care of the manufacturing and shipping of the DVDs in real-time as the orders come in. The costs are very reasonable at $1.75 for the DVD & cover plus a $3 handling charge which is passed on to the customer. Kunaki offers several reasonably priced options for shipping both in the US and internationally. The product can be shipped via expedited shipping methods if customers want to pay for it. To get started you simply upload the files to Kunaki via their website and start taking orders. It couldn’t be any easier.

DVDs are attractive to information marketers for several reasons. First of all, there’s the high perceived value of DVDs when compared to books or online videos. What’s the price of a book? Anyone can go to a bookstore anywhere in the US and purchase a book for $20 or less. You’re likely to be disappointed if you expect to sell your book for more than $20. By contrast, DVDs are routinely sold for $100 or more…and the cost of the manufacturing the DVD is $1.75 including the cover. That leaves a lot of room for huge profit margins. And there’s no middleman to share the profits with since you’re self-publishing your DVD.
